What is Triple Homicide?
A triple homicide is a rare and devastating criminal act in which three or more individuals are killed in a single incident. This type of crime is often considered one of the most heinous and disturbing, as it involves the intentional taking of multiple lives in a short period of time. Definition
A triple homicide is a type of multiple murder that involves the killing of three or more individuals in a single incident. This can occur in a variety of settings, including homes, public places, and even on the streets. The victims may be related to each other, such as family members or friends, or they may be unrelated individuals who are brought together by circumstance.

Consequences
The consequences of triple homicide can be severe and far-reaching. Some of the potential consequences include:
• Emotional trauma: The families and loved ones of the victims may experience significant emotional trauma, including grief, anxiety, and depression.
• Community impact: Triple homicide can have a significant impact on the community, leading to increased fear and mistrust.
• Legal consequences: The perpetrator of a triple homicide may face severe legal consequences, including life imprisonment or the death penalty.
• Investigation and prosecution: The investigation and prosecution of a triple homicide can be complex and time-consuming, requiring significant resources and expertise.
